Jobs.ca
Jobs.ca
Language
Docker, Inc logo

Growth Engineer

Docker, Inc19 days ago
Remote
Remote (Canada, US)
$172,000 - $215,000/yearly
Mid Level

Top Benefits

100% company paid medical premiums for employees and dependents
Flexible Time Off Policy
Whaleness Days — At least 1 company wide day off per month

About the role

Who you are

  • 3+ years of experience in software engineering, ideally within a growth, experimentation, or product-focused team
  • Proficient in JavaScript (React preferred) and at least one backend language such as Go or Python
  • Experienced in designing and executing A/B tests, ideally in production environments
  • Skilled in analyzing user behavior and product metrics, using tools like Heap, Looker, Mixpanel, or Snowflake
  • Familiar with Docker’s architecture and/or experience contributing to internal systems like Pinata or SaaS-Mega is a plus
  • Comfortable working across product surfaces (web, desktop, cloud) and layers (frontend, backend, APIs, internal tooling)
  • Strong communicator and collaborator with a pragmatic approach to experimentation and iteration
  • Outcome-oriented and self-directed, with a passion for improving developer experience and product usability at scale

What the job involves

  • We are looking for a Growth Engineer to join our Growth Product team and directly contribute to Docker’s product-led growth engine
  • This role will partner closely with Product, Design, Marketing, and Data to build, launch, and optimize high-impact growth experiments across Docker Desktop, Hub, Scout, and more
  • This is a full-stack engineering role focused on delivering measurable business outcomes like increased activation, retention, and expansion—by using code, data, and experimentation to help millions of developers get to value faster
  • Build and ship behavior-based user experiences that drive onboarding, activation, and retention across Docker’s product suite
  • Design and implement end-to-end growth experiments—from hypothesis to implementation to post-launch analysis
  • Use product data and funnel analytics to identify friction, uncover opportunities, and prioritize engineering work that delivers business impact
  • Collaborate with Product, Design, Data, Marketing, and Ops teams to deliver high-velocity experiments that improve core funnel metrics
  • Write production-grade code across Docker’s stack, including frontend (React/JavaScript), backend (Go/Python), and cloud services
  • Own implementation and maintenance of tracking instrumentation for Heap and Looker dashboards
  • Own implementation of Adobe Target as an experimentation, personalization, and optimization engine
  • Leverage A/B testing frameworks and in-app engagement tools to optimize personalized user journeys
  • Build internal tools and automation to support rapid iteration and testing infrastructure
  • Share experiment outcomes, insights, and next-step recommendations with stakeholders across product and business functions
  • In the first 30 days:
  • Onboard with the PLG team and our experimentation framework
  • Ship your first experiment or product improvement with guidance from senior teammates
  • Familiarize yourself with Docker’s codebases, analytics, and growth metrics
  • In the first 90 days:
  • Own and deliver multiple growth experiments across core surfaces
  • Improve tracking, dashboards, or in-app engagement in targeted PLG flows
  • Partner with PMs and analysts to iterate based on results and user signals
  • In the first year:
  • Deliver measurable improvements to key metrics such as activation, retention, or expansion
  • Contribute to a repeatable growth experimentation system that supports Docker’s self-service revenue goals
  • Influence the direction of Docker’s growth engine and become a technical leader within the PLG team

Benefits

  • 100% company paid medical premiums for employees and dependents
  • Flexible Time Off Policy
  • “Whaleness” Days — At least 1 company wide day off per month
  • Employer Paid Holidays
  • Generous Maternity and Parental Leave
  • Home Office Set Up Budget
  • Monthly Technology Stipend
  • Training Allowances
  • Life and Disability Insurance
  • Retirement Plans
  • Virtual and In-Person Social Events
  • Docker Swag
  • Quarterly Hackathons
  • Virtual Coffee with Co-Workers

About Docker, Inc

Software Development
501-1000

At Docker, we simplify the lives of developers who are making world-changing apps. Docker helps developers bring their ideas to reality by conquering the complexity of app development. We simplify and accelerate workflows with an integrated development pipeline and application components. Actively used by millions of developers around the world, Docker Desktop and Docker Hub provide unmatched simplicity, agility and choice.